But let’s save the final Oscars tally for another day. Today, we celebrate cinema—and what better way to do that than by streaming these award-winning films? Before you start Googling, we’ve made it easy for you. Here’s a list of the Oscar-winning films currently available on Indian OTT platforms.
Animated Short
In the Shadow of the Cypress
Documentary Short
The Only Girl in the Orchestra (Netflix)
Live-Action Short
I’m Not a Robot
Original Song
“El Mal,” Emilia Pérez (Mubi)
Makeup and Hairstyling
Marilyne Scarselli, The Substance (Mubi)
Sound
Dune: Part Two (JioHotstar)
Visual Effects
Dune: Part Two (JioHotstar)
Costume Design
Paul Tazewell, Wicked (Zee5)
Production Design
Wicked (Zee5)
Original Score
Daniel Blumberg, The Brutalist
Cinematography
Lol Crawley, The Brutalist
Editing
Sean Baker, Anora (Zee5)
International Feature
I’m Still Here (Brazil)
Documentary Feature
No Other Land
Animated Feature
Flow
Adapted Screenplay
Peter Straughan, Conclave
Original Screenplay
Sean Baker, Anora (Zee5)
Best Director
Sean Baker, Anora (Zee5)
Best Supporting Actress
Zoe Saldaña, Emilia Pérez (Mubi)
Best Supporting Actor
Kieran Culkin, A Real Pain
Best Actress
Mikey Madison, Anora (Zee5)
Best Actor
Adrien Brody, The Brutalist
Best Picture
Anora (Zee5)
